Comprehensive coverage of the results of the tenth round of the Premier Basketball League, where Al-Ula continued its lead with a sweeping victory, and Al-Ittihad, Al-Ahli and Al-Nasr achieved important victories.

The first basketball team of Al-Ula Club continued to make history in the Premier Basketball League competitions, confirming its firm determination to compete strongly this season, as it succeeded in maintaining its lead in the general standings with a perfect score without any setbacks, after achieving a great and well-deserved victory over its counterpart Al-Salam.

In the tenth round of matches, which saw a high scoring rate, Al-Ula secured a decisive victory against Al-Salam with a score of 111-81. The match took place on Friday evening at the Prince Mohammed bin Abdulaziz Sports City Hall in Medina, where Al-Ula dominated from the outset, finishing the first half with a comfortable 50-38 lead. They continued to widen the gap in the second half thanks to their well-organized defense and offense.

Al-Nasr triumphs over Al-Ahli... and Al-Ittihad strikes hard

At the same venue in Medina, another intense match took place between Al-Nasr and Uhud, with Al-Nasr securing a resounding victory of 98-58. Al-Nasr's offensive intentions were evident early on, as they finished the first half with a commanding 22-point lead (55-33), making it difficult for Uhud to mount a comeback in the second half.

In Jeddah, Al-Ittihad recorded the biggest win of this round, and perhaps one of the biggest this season, when they crushed their guest Al-Khawildiyah 135-56. The match, held at Al-Ittihad's home arena, served as an offensive training session for the team, who finished the first half with a 56-24 lead, demonstrating a vast technical advantage and high level of physical readiness to compete for titles.

Eastern Region Victories

Moving to the Eastern Province, specifically to the Prince Nayef bin Abdulaziz Sports Hall in Qatif, Al-Fateh regained its usual composure after defeating Al-Khaleej 69-51. The match was characterized by its defensive nature, with Al-Fateh finishing the first half ahead 36-22 and maintaining its lead until the final whistle.

In the same arena, Al-Ahli faced little difficulty in overcoming Mudhar, securing a resounding victory of 112-65. Al-Ahli dominated the match from start to finish, ending the first half with a 57-22 lead, thus demonstrating their readiness to compete with the top teams in the upcoming rounds.

Implications of the results and competition

The results of the tenth round reflect the growing technical gap between the leading teams and the rest of the league, with three matches exceeding 100 points for the winning team. This indicates the formidable offensive prowess of Al-Ula, Al-Ittihad, and Al-Ahli. Al-Ula deserves credit for this exceptional performance, which aligns with the significant sporting activity taking place in the province, making them strong contenders to break the traditional monopoly on titles and add a new dimension to the competition in Saudi basketball.
